How often Should You arrange Cleaning Services?Figuring out the frequency of cleaning services depends on several factors, including the type of facility, foot traffic, and specific industry requirements. For instance, high-traffic areas such as retail stores or medical facilities usually demand daily cleaning to sustain hygiene and appearance. Conversely, offices with lower foot traffic might need services on a weekly or bi-weekly schedule.Moreover, sectors with strict regulatory requirements, including food production or healthcare, may dictate more regular cleaning to adhere to safety protocols. Time-based variations can likewise influence scheduling; for instance, during peak business periods, heightened cleaning may be warranted to accommodate larger crowds.Ultimately, organizations should assess their specific needs and consult with cleaning service providers to establish an suitable schedule. Furthermore, service plan options can further influence total costs, enabling companies to adjust their cleaning requirements to their financial plan.Factors Influencing PriceKnowing the factors that determine cleaning service costs can aid clients in making well-informed decisions. Multiple elements contribute to pricing, including space size, cleaning frequency, and specific services. Larger spaces generally result in higher costs because of the increased labor and materials necessary. Furthermore, the type of cleaning—such as standard, deep, or specialized services—may greatly affect pricing. The geographic location is important, since labor rates and operational costs vary by region. Additionally, contract length may affect pricing; longer contracts often yield discounted rates. Clients should also consider the reputation and experience of the cleaning service provider, as reputable companies may charge premium rates for their expertise and reliability.
